Saudia Cargo ups the ante

Proof that the sector is seeing light at the end of the tunnel comes with Saudia Cargo's decision to enhance its Hong Kong service schedules.

Unsurprisingly, the enhancement is down to consumer behaviour.

To meet the increasing demands of the e-commerce business, the carrier is scheduling three additional passenger/freighter flights from Hong Kong. The operations will be carried out with its B787 Dreamliner every Sunday, Monday and Wednesday.

These added flights are an increment to the existing capacity that comprises nine weekly freighter scheduled services.
